Ceramic Dielectric Filter for 5G Base Station Market Size

The global Ceramic Dielectric Filter for 5G Base Station market is projected to grow from US$ 2613.6 million in 2023 to US$ 3175.7 million by 2029, at a Compound Annual Growth Rate (CAGR) of 3.3% during the forecast period.

Ceramic Dielectric Filter for 5G Base Station Market

Ceramic Dielectric Filter for 5G Base Station Market

Dielectric Filter for 5G is a filter that uses a dielectric resonator. Dielectric resonator is a piece of dielectric (nonconductive) material that is designed to function as a resonator for radio waves, generally in the microwave and millimeter wave bands.
Global Dielectric Filter for 5G key players include Murata, Caiqin Technology, Ube Electronics, DSBJ, Partron, etc. Global top five manufacturers hold a share over 50%. China is the largest market, with a share over 50%, followed by South Korea and Europe, total have a share over 25 percent. In terms of product, 2.6Hz is the largest segment, with a share about 70%. And in terms of application, the largest application is Big Base Station, followed by Small Base Station.
